StockRoute Planner — onboarding. This service builds restock routes for Fizzbo vending machines across the Harlow Pike depots. Cron kicks planning at 04:00; output lands in the dispatch queue. Config lives in the planner repo; don't hand-edit the fleet table. If the scheduler account locks out, recovery goes through the Fizzbo ops vault, not IT. Admin console creds rotate quarterly. To unseal the vault after a lockout, you need the recovery passphrase on file, which is exactly the one below.

unlock words, yawig-kagef: gordor-holvan-ulaael-pramir-ulaiel-tamdor

## Changelog — Lanternloop v2.8

Changed defaults: after weeks of flaky DNS lookups against the internal resolver, we bumped the resolution timeout, added two retries with jitter, and now cache negative results for 30 seconds. Should kill the intermittent startup failures on the Brimfold cluster. New defaults are below.

service settings:
PRAIX_LOG_LEVEL=error
PRAIX_METRICS_HOST=metrics.praix.qorvelcorp.corp
PRAIX_POOL_SIZE=16

Onboarding: Fareweave rules engine. It evaluates shipping-fee rules in priority order; first match wins. Rules live in `rules/fees/` as YAML, validated in CI. Don't hand-edit prod configs — redeploy via the Tollgate pipeline. Ask Priya in the sync if a rule misfires. Deploys must be signed with the key below.

rollout seal: bky4_yke3